AI Game Recap AI

Rangers Fall to Sabres 5-3 in Crucial Matchup

In a critical playoff push showdown, the Buffalo Sabres defeated the New York Rangers 5-3 on April 8, 2026. The game saw several momentum swings, but the Sabres capitalized on key opportunities, securing their win with strong offensive play in the third period.

Big Picture

Prior to the game, the Rangers were looking to build on their recent success, winning four of their last five games. However, despite a spirited effort and moments of brilliance, they were unable to maintain their advantage after taking the lead in the second period. The Sabres, who had been struggling recently, improved their standing with this victory, showcasing their resilience and ability to respond under pressure.

Turning Point

The turning point came early in the third period. After the Rangers took a 3-2 lead with Adam Fox's goal at 14:44 of the second period, the momentum swung back sharply when Alex Tuch scored for the Sabres just over five minutes into the third. This goal not only tied the game but also shifted the energy in the arena, with the Sabres capturing control. Subsequently, Jason Zucker and Zach Benson added two more markers, sealing the game for Buffalo and leaving the Rangers unable to recover.

Standout Performances

Alexis Lafrenière stood out for the Rangers, scoring two goals, including the one that momentarily tied the game at 2-2. Adam Fox also contributed a goal and an assist, showcasing his playmaking skills and importance to the team.

On the Sabres’ side, Zach Benson was particularly impressive, netting two goals and providing a strong offensive presence. Ryan McLeod also had a notable performance with a goal and an assist. Ultimately, the Sabres' balanced attack proved more effective, as they outshot the Rangers 27 to 20 and were able to finish key scoring chances.
